Intermediary approval permits entities to form companies to offer permitted securities market services in IFSCs. Recognised entities desirous of operating in an IFSC as an intermediary may form a company to provide financial services relating to the securities market, as permitted by the Board under the SEBI (International Financial Services Centres) Guidelines, 2015.
